India’s star pacer Mohammed Shami on Friday forged his vote in Amroha throughout the second section of Lok Sabha elections. After casting his vote, Shami urged residents to train their franchise and “elect the government of their choice”. “I just want to say that every citizen has the right to cast their votes and elect the government of their choice…It is a matter of pride for me that PM Narendra Modi took my name during his speech (in Amroha) and praised me and my game,” Shami instructed the media. Voting was held in eight parliamentary constituencies of Uttar Pradesh – Amroha, Meerut, Baghpat, Ghaziabad, Gautam Budh Nagar, Aligarh, Mathura, and Bulandshahr throughout the second section of Lok Sabha polls.

Voting started at 7 am on Friday in 88 constituencies throughout 13 states and union territories for the second section of the Lok Sabha polls.

Earlier in February, PM Modi wished a speedy restoration to Shami, who efficiently underwent an operation on his Achilles tendon.

Shami is at the moment in rehabilitation from an Achilles tendon damage. On April 19, Shami supplied his followers with an damage replace and stated that he can not wait to make a comeback.

Taking to Instagram, Shami wrote within the caption of his reel, “Injuries don’t define you, your comeback will… Can’t wait to be back out there with my team! #mdshami #recoveryjourney #shami #mdshami11”

Shami will not be taking part in within the ongoing Indian Premier League (IPL) season, the place he was presupposed to play for the Gujarat Titans (GT) and in addition missed the five-match Test sequence in opposition to England at house in January-March this 12 months resulting from damage.

The 33-year-old final represented India within the ODI World Cup last in opposition to Australia in November. The senior pacer completed because the event’s highest wicket-taker and took 24 wickets in solely seven matches.

Shami performed by ache in that event, however he didn’t enable his ache to have an effect on his efficiency. He later missed the tour to South Africa following the event and the three-match T20I sequence in opposition to Afghanistan in January.
